Output 71156c62b48c40e7b1e291d24beb0152c1aa87215d258060dfb16ecb22bea4b3:22

value
38251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77d54655edec2a12ea6b494a0bac1f2e5eb93ba7 OP_EQUAL
address
3CcdpxgidW1Mj2t55qK5SJG7YZMTfQwtCj
transaction
71156c62b48c40e7b1e291d24beb0152c1aa87215d258060dfb16ecb22bea4b3
spent
true